Bagatur, I really do not understand this thread. The Proto-Bulgars were either a Turcic tribe or an Iranian tribe. But they were few. They conquered the people of present day Bulgaria and established a kingdom where the ruling class were Proto-Bulgars and the vast amount of people were the result of mixing between Slavs and indigenous Thracians. All the above can be found in any book on European History. After 1300 years, the Proto-Bulgars, were they of Turcic or Iranian origin, have been completely absorbed and vanished in the sea of Slavo-Thracians. So, the very quastion "Are Bulgarians Europenas ?
